I have completed first year of B.Sc but want to pursue B.Sc (Hons) in any specialisation. What is the procedure to do the same?

You usually begin your first year in B.Sc (Hons) to achieve a specialization, in which case, it would generally be taken right from the first year since it rarely happens that one could do credit transfer between a regular B.Sc and honours programs.
